Even though Huawei got banned by Google, they are still running Android (since it's open source) and Huawei launched their own app store which made people able to use any of the apps they want since you can install anything on Android with apk files.

 

Windows Phone was a completely different OS with a completely different core (you can imagine it as the mobile version of a Windows PC but even more optimized) so it needed brand new apps for it. The phones got popular but rivals like Google & etc refused to release their apps at those days in fear of competition & it's usage slowly decreased as their app store never grew like iOS or Android. 

 

It was literally the most opimized mobile OS we ever got (more optimized than iOS & Android) as it was running beyond fluid even on 512mb ram phones :rip:.
